Isuzu D-Max maintains its No.1 position ahead of Hilux as Thailand's best-selling truck and car in Sept 2022

Pick-up trucks are king in Thailand but there can only be one that deserves the crown and for the 9th month in a row, itā€™s the Isuzu D-Max at the top.

18,457 units of the Isuzu pick-up truck were sold in the Kingdom in September 2022 as it held on to its position as Thailandā€™s best-selling car and truck of the year so far with 137,033 units. This also translates to a 57.21% market share in the pick-up segment.

Meanwhile taking second place for the ninth time in a row is the Toyota Hilux with 10,390 units sold in September. Between January and September, 109,037 units of the Hilux were sold nationwide.

Based on sales data, only the D-Max and Hilux achieved 5-figure sales every month. Another consistent duo are the Ford Ranger and Mitsubishi Triton which also saw 4-figure sales in each month.

Ford sold 3,580 units of the Ranger in September while 1,539 units of the Mitsubishi Triton were sold in the same month.

The remainder of the sales chart consists of the Nissan Navara, MG Extender, and Mazda BT-50. Though placed last overall, September saw the highest sales figure for the BT-50 with 269 units sold in Thailand.
